Glencar named on £50m Minecraft attraction
Glencar has been named main contractor on a £50m Minecraft-themed attraction at Chessington World of Adventures. The contractor is delivering Minecraft World for Merlin Entertainments, which is developing the scheme with Minecraft owner Mojang Studios.
